New Mind Set

I think I've found a different mind set the last few days/weeks. I feel like I'm semi-plateaued and quite honestly it's not sitting well with me. I check my weight frequently through out the week because it helps keep me on track. It's the right thing for me to do.

As I've seen myself bounce up and down from week to week, it's frustrating. But I think I've deduced a few things that are going to help me in the future.

1. Calories/Calorie Counting - As a good friend pointed out, you "think" you can stay on budget with your calories after a while of logging them. So you go at it without logging them. You come to realize your either overeating or under eating. I fall into both categories. Not any more. I HAVE to log my calories. It is the only sure fire method for me to ensure that I'm maintaining just the right amount of calories to keep the weight coming off.

2. Calories, Part II - I've found that I'm supposedly supposed to consume 2,030 calories per day to ensure a 1 to 2 pound loss per week. Well, there are a few other factors that play into this figure that I don't believe are truly being accounted for. For starters I'm still breastfeeding, that alone allows me 300-500 extra calories while nursing. So THAT number isn't accounted for in the 2,030. Therefore I have been severely under-eating. What's worse is I had been trying to stick to a lower 1,800 calories. Can you say insufficient? No wonder I've been having sleep issues and feeling hungry at weird hours. So I now resolve to eat NO LESS than 2,030 calories per day and I'm going to try to stay under 2,300, just to be on the safe side. I've given it a trial run and seriously have noticed an improvement with the added calories to my diet.
